If you have ever chewed a piece of sugar-free gum, brushed with a natural toothpaste, or picked up a bag of "sugar-free" baking sweetener, you have almost certainly already met xylitol. It is one of the most widely used sugar substitutes in the world, yet most people know surprisingly little about it beyond the small warning on the package. Understanding what xylitol actually is, what it can and cannot do for your health, and where its real risks lie will help you decide whether it deserves a place in your kitchen and daily routine.
Xylitol belongs to a family of compounds called sugar alcohols, or polyols. Despite the name, these substances contain no ethanol, so there is nothing intoxicating about them. Chemically, xylitol is a five-carbon sugar alcohol that occurs naturally in small amounts in many fruits and vegetables, including plums, strawberries, cauliflower, and mushrooms. Commercially, it is usually extracted from hardwoods such as birch or from corn cobs, then purified into white crystals that look remarkably similar to table sugar. This natural origin is one reason xylitol has a better reputation among health-conscious consumers than some artificial sweeteners.
In terms of taste and function, xylitol comes closer to real sugar than almost any other alternative. It is roughly as sweet as sucrose, with a clean sweetness and no bitter aftertaste. It also provides bulk, which matters in baking, because many zero-calorie sweeteners simply cannot replace the volume and texture that sugar contributes to a recipe. On the calorie side, xylitol contains about 2.4 calories per gram compared with sugar's 4, so it trims calories without eliminating them entirely. Its glycemic index is very low, generally cited in the single digits to low teens, versus around 65 for table sugar. This means it produces a much smaller rise in blood glucose, which is a significant part of its appeal for people managing diabetes or simply trying to reduce blood sugar swings.
The dental connection is where xylitol truly stands apart from other sweeteners, and it is the reason it appears in so many gums, mints, and oral care products. Tooth decay develops when bacteria in dental plaque, particularly Streptococcus mutans, digest sugars and produce acids that erode enamel. Xylitol disrupts this process in an interesting way: the bacteria can attempt to consume it, but they cannot metabolize it effectively. Over time, regular xylitol exposure appears to reduce the growth of these cavity-causing bacteria and lessen acid production in the mouth. Chewing xylitol-sweetened gum also stimulates saliva flow, and saliva is the mouth's natural defense system, helping neutralize acids and remineralize early enamel damage. Interest in this effect dates back to research in Finland in the early 1970s, and dental professionals have taken it seriously ever since. While xylitol is not a substitute for brushing, flossing, and professional care, using it after meals is a reasonable addition to an oral hygiene routine.
For people watching their blood sugar, xylitol offers another practical advantage. Because it is absorbed and metabolized slowly and incompletely, it causes a far gentler glucose response than sugar. Many people with type 2 diabetes use it as a way to keep some sweetness in their diet without the sharp spikes that sugar causes. That said, anyone taking medication that affects blood glucose should discuss sweetener use with their doctor or dietitian, since individual responses vary and total carbohydrate intake still matters.
Now for the part that catches many first-time users off guard: digestion. Like other sugar alcohols, xylitol is poorly absorbed in the small intestine. Whatever is not absorbed travels to the colon, where it draws in water and ferments. In practical terms, eating too much at once can cause bloating, gas, stomach rumbling, and a laxative effect that ranges from mild urgency to genuine distress. People sometimes discover this the hard way after eating several pieces of sugar-free gum or a few servings of sugar-free candy in a short period. The good news is that tolerance usually improves with gradual exposure. If you are introducing xylitol, start with a small amount, perhaps a teaspoon or a few grams per day, and increase slowly over a couple of weeks. Most adults find that moderate amounts, spread throughout the day, are perfectly comfortable, though individuals with irritable bowel syndrome or other sensitive digestive systems may prefer to be especially cautious.
In the kitchen, xylitol behaves more like sugar than most alternatives, but it has a few quirks worth knowing. It substitutes one-for-one by volume in most recipes, dissolves in liquids, and sweetens beverages, sauces, and baked goods reliably. It does not caramelize the way sugar does, so you cannot use it to make caramel or achieve the same browning on a crème brûlée. It will not feed yeast, which makes it unsuitable for breads that rely on fermentation for rise, though you can still add it for flavor in yeast doughs. Some people notice a subtle cooling sensation on the tongue, especially in concentrated applications like mints or frosting; this happens because xylitol absorbs heat as it dissolves. It is also hygroscopic, meaning it pulls moisture, which can slightly soften the texture of cookies over a few days. None of these quirks are dealbreakers, but they are worth factoring in when adapting favorite recipes.
There is one safety issue that every household using xylitol must take seriously, and it concerns dogs, not people. Xylitol is extremely toxic to dogs. In dogs, even small amounts trigger a rapid release of insulin, causing a dangerous drop in blood sugar that can occur within thirty minutes to a few hours of ingestion. Larger doses can lead to seizures and acute liver failure, and the outcome can be fatal without prompt veterinary treatment. Because xylitol appears in an ever-growing list of products, sugar-free gum, candy, peanut butter, baked goods, and even some medications and oral care products, dog owners need to check labels carefully. A dog that eats sugar-free gum should be treated as an emergency, not a wait-and-see situation. Keep all xylitol-containing products stored securely and out of a pet's reach. It is also worth keeping xylitol-sweetened foods away from other pets and small children, both because of the digestive effects and because concentrated doses are simply not appropriate for them.
How does xylitol compare with the other sweeteners you might be choosing between? Erythritol, another popular sugar alcohol, is nearly calorie-free and generally easier on the digestive system, but it lacks xylitol's documented dental benefits and can have a slightly cooling aftertaste in larger quantities. Stevia and monk fruit are intensely sweet plant-derived zero-calorie options, but they provide no bulk and can carry flavor notes that some people find off-putting. Regular sugar, of course, tastes familiar and performs perfectly in recipes, but it brings the calories, the glycemic impact, and the cavity risk that many people are trying to avoid. Xylitol occupies a useful middle ground: it tastes and behaves much like sugar, offers genuine oral health advantages, and moderates blood sugar impact, at the cost of some digestive caution and a real hazard for dogs.
If you decide to buy xylitol, quality and labeling matter. Look for food-grade xylitol from a reputable brand, and check whether the product is non-GMO if that is important to you, since much of the world's supply comes from corn. Beware of blends labeled as "xylitol sweetener" that actually mix xylitol with other ingredients; these can behave differently in recipes. Store it in a sealed container in a dry place, as it can clump when exposed to humidity. Price is typically higher than sugar and higher than many artificial sweeteners, so most people use it selectively, in coffee, in homemade treats, or as gum after meals, rather than replacing all the sugar in their pantry.
Xylitol is neither a miracle ingredient nor something to fear. Used thoughtfully, it is one of the best-tasting and most functional sugar substitutes available, with meaningful benefits for dental health and blood sugar management. Used carelessly, in large doses or within reach of a dog, it can cause real problems. The sensible approach is the one that applies to most things in nutrition: start small, pay attention to how your body responds, read labels, and keep it away from your pets. With those simple precautions, xylitol can be a practical and pleasant part of a lower-sugar lifestyle.
